A Practical Look at the Dark Angels Tarot Deck

Today I'm going to talk a little bit about the Dark Angels Tarot Deck. The lovely Cassandra Curtis bought this deck for me for my birthday this year, and I've been playing with it since the end of August. The artwork is stunning. Simply beautiful. This is probably one of the prettiest decks I own. If you like gothic art, this will likely appeal to you. The cards depict the dark angels during the end of days, so as you can imagine the look and feel of the cards is edgy - bordering on sinister.

The little white book included in the box is in tune with the dark atmosphere of the cards. Some of the cards veer off quite a bit from the traditional Rider Waite meaning, and the cards don't have the name descriptors printed on them. Major Arcana cards are marked by number, and the rest of the cards are marked by symbols, so it can take some studying to read this deck the way the creator intended. My first few readings with the cards, I used the LWB (little white book), but I've since retired it to the box. I've found I prefer to read the Dark Angels deck like a traditional Rider Waite deck, incorporating only slight variations of the traditional meanings based on the art. The readings come across more accurate for me that way.

For practical, day-to-day use, I would recommend this deck for an intermediate to experienced tarot reader, or as a specialty deck to break out at events with a dark atmosphere. (How fun!) If you plan to read this deck for another person, and you're not intending the reading to be for entertainment purposes only, it's important to keep in mind that life is both positive and negative, light and darkness, so be sure to adjust the reading accordingly. 

Overall, what a cool deck to add to your collection!  This is a beautiful, atmospheric deck for tarot readers that know their way around the Rider Waite deck. Yule is coming up, and I can vouch for this one - it makes a great gift for fans of dark art and tarot.
